    31 dresses in 31 days. That's the Frocktober goal that Lexi from Sydney-based blog Pottymouthmama has set for herself, in a frockin' good effort to raise funds for a frockin' good cause, the Ovarian Cancer Research Foundation. Lexi is 10 days into Frocktober and has so far raised $3,264.75. She still needs $6,735.25 to reach her goal of raising $10,000, so get donating, birdies! Ovarian cancer is the leading cause of death of all gynaecological cancers. Every single dollar that Lexi raises goes to the Ovarian Cancer Research Foundation, who are working hard on finding an early detection test. Currently there is none.
